AN OLD BABYLONIAN HAEMATITE CYLINDER SEAL
CIRCA EARLY 2ND MILLENNIUM B.C.
With an offering scene, two worshippers, one with hands held up in supplication and the other holding a small horned animal, before the Sun-god, Shamash, standing holding a dagger, a dog sitting behind, with three lines of cuneiform reading: 'Kurum, son of Taribum, the servant of Amurru'
1 1/8 in. (2.7 cm.) high
Provenance
Anonymous sale; Numismatic Ancient Art & Coins, Zürich, 20 November 1987, no. 15.
Private collection, Germany.
